About crypto

Cryptocurrency, rooted in blockchain technology, has disrupted traditional financial systems. Bitcoin, Ethereum, and other cryptocurrencies offer decentralized and secure methods of transferring value. Beyond just digital currencies, the underlying blockchain technology has found applications in various industries, ensuring transparent and tamper-proof transactions. Smart contracts, built on blockchain platforms, automate and enforce contractual agreements without the need for intermediaries. Cryptocurrency and blockchain continue to evolve, exploring new avenues such as decentralized finance (DeFi) and non-fungible tokens (NFTs).

Smart Contracts in Practice

Smart contracts are self-executing programs stored on a blockchain that run automatically when predefined conditions are met. They remove the need for manual intermediaries—no escrow agents, no paper contracts, no back-and-forth approvals. Business logic is encoded directly on-chain, so once triggered, execution is deterministic and tamper-proof. When Blockchain Fits

Use this comparison to assess whether the trust, transparency, and multi-party requirements of your project justify a blockchain architecture over a conventional centralized system.

Centralized ArchitectureBlockchain-Based Architecture
Trust modelSingle authority controls and validates dataDistributed consensus — no single point of control
Data immutabilityRecords can be altered or deleted by administratorsEntries are cryptographically sealed and tamper-resistant
Multiple parties involvedOne organization owns and manages the systemMultiple independent parties share and verify the same ledger
Transparency requirementsAccess and audit trails controlled internallyTransactions visible and verifiable by all participants
Performance needsHigh throughput, low latency — well-suited for speedLower throughput; latency increases with network size
Infrastructure costLower operational cost at scaleHigher cost due to node operation and consensus overhead
Regulatory traceabilityAudit logs managed by one party — trust depends on themIndependent audit trail verifiable without relying on any single party
